Output 95709f378059d090b67a674ac97190682aa672ffe571ccc36855ad77e2a86e54:1

value
3099880
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28d9272668b276866134dacf1ef941a905829e4a OP_EQUALVERIFY OP_CHECKSIG
address
14izAixA174BWAGTf9wz2dN2hnakrPj2Ni
transaction
95709f378059d090b67a674ac97190682aa672ffe571ccc36855ad77e2a86e54
confirmations
424835
spent
true